Samsung Galaxy Fold India launch Scheduled on October 1

Samsung Galaxy Fold a hybrid of Tablet and Phone . Samsung took the risk of Sending out review units to Online reviewers who ended up messing up the units by peeling the what it seemed like a Screen Protector. but it turnedd ot to the part of the display and caused display issues and also for some Reviewers things got stuck in between the hinges and messed up the device. This issues tormed up on the Internet and Samsung called back all the units and the took months to resolve the mentioned issues. And now they come up with the fixed and redesigned Samsung Galaxy Fold.
The redesigned Samsung Galaxy Fold is set to launch on September 27 in USA and on October 1 on India. Regarding the price The basic 4G LTE model starts at $1,980 and 5G version is priced over $2000 dollars. Samsung Galaxy Fold Speecifications:

  • A stunning 7.3 inch Dynamic AMOLED display Primary display along with a 4.6 inch Display on the back.
  • Powered by Qualcomm Snapdragon 855 processor , which is a octa core CPU and the primary performance core is clocked at 2.85 GHz and the three cores are clocked at 2.42 GHz and remaining three power efficient cores are clocked at 1.78 GHz .
  • Speaking of camera Samsung Galaxy Fold have six cameras the primary set of camera consists of a 12 MP wide angle camera and another 12 MP telephoto camera and a 16 MP ultra wide camera. Also it have two selfie camera consists of 10 MP wide camera and another 8 MP camera.And also there is a 10 MP camera over the cover display
  • 4380 mAh battery with support for Fast charging.
  • 3.1 Usb type c
  • Bluetooth 5.0 with aotX HD
  • Reverse WIreless Charging
  • Side mounted fingerprint
  • Available in two colours Space Silver and Cosmos Black
  • Samsung Galaxy Fold will feel little heavier with a weight of 276 grams
  • 12 GB RAM coupled with512 GB internal storage
  • Runs on Android Pie
  • Stereo speakers and bundled Samsung Galaxy Buds
  • No 3.5mm headphone jack
